What is a Pragmatic Slot?
A pragmatic slot is a placeholder in a sentence or dialogue that is created to capture particular pieces of information that pertain to the context or the function of the communication. These slots are not simply syntactic or semantic placeholders however are deeply rooted in the pragmatic aspects of language, which handle the context and the designated meaning behind words and sentences.
For example, in the sentence "I desire to reserve a flight from New York to Los Angeles," the pragmatic slots may include:
- Source Location: New York
- Destination Location: Los Angeles
- Date of Travel: (if specified in the dialogue)
- Class of Travel: (if specified in the discussion)
Each of these slots records a piece of details that is vital for the task of reserving a flight. The concept of pragmatic slots is especially useful in discussion systems, where the objective is to extract and use specific details from user inputs to perform actions or provide appropriate responses.

Applications of Pragmatic Slots
Pragmatic slots are extensively used in numerous applications, including:
- Virtual Assistants: Smart assistants like Siri, Alexa, and Google Assistant use pragmatic slots to understand user requests and offer appropriate actions. For example, when a user asks, "What's the weather like in London tomorrow?" the system recognizes the slots for place (London) and date (tomorrow) to fetch the proper weather information.
- Customer Support Chatbots: Chatbots in consumer support use pragmatic slots to gather required details from users and fix their issues. For example, if a user needs to reset a password, the chatbot may identify slots for user ID, security questions, and brand-new password.
- E-commerce Platforms: In e-commerce, pragmatic slots assist in filtering and looking for products based upon user questions. For instance, "Show me red dresses under ₤ 50" would have slots for color (red), category (gowns), and rate variety (₤ 50).
- Health care Systems: In healthcare, pragmatic slots can be used to catch client information and signs, assisting in medical diagnosis and treatment suggestions. For instance, "I have a headache and a fever" may be parsed into signs (headache, fever).

Difficulties in Implementing Pragmatic Slots
While the concept of pragmatic slots is effective, implementing them successfully can be challenging. Some typical issues consist of:
- Ambiguity: User inputs can be ambiguous, making it challenging to fill slots properly. For example, "I want to go to the airport" might mean different things depending on the context.
- Insufficient Information: Users might not offer all the essential info in one go, needing the system to ask follow-up concerns.
- Natural Language Variations: Users can reveal the same details in different ways, which can make complex slot filling. For example, "Departure time" could be expressed as "When do I leave?" or "What's the flight time?"

Frequently asked questions
Q: What is the difference in between a pragmatic slot and a semantic slot?A: A semantic slot focuses on the meaning of the words or phrases in a sentence, whereas a pragmatic slot is interested in the practical, context-specific information that is required to carry out a task or action.
Q: How are pragmatic slots used in virtual assistants?A: Virtual assistants utilize pragmatic slots to parse user commands and draw out the essential details to carry out actions. For example, "Set a timer for 10 minutes" would have a slot for the duration (10 minutes).
Q: Can pragmatic slots be utilized in languages aside from English?A: Yes, pragmatic slots are language-agnostic and can be utilized in any language. Nevertheless, the NLP models and slot definitions require to be adapted to the particular linguistic and cultural context.
